/** \file
* \ingroup fn
* An #MFContext is passed along with every call to a multi-function. Right now it does nothing,
* but it can be used for the following purposes:
* - Pass debug information up and down the function call stack.
* - Pass reusable memory buffers to sub-functions to increase performance.
* - Pass cached data to called functions.
